AMD: Move RAMBASE and RAMTOP

There are no reasons to not load ramstage @ 0x100000.

Boards with HAVE_ACPI_RESUME enabled have performance penalty in using
excessive RAMTOP. For these boards, this change releases 11 MiB of RAM from CBMEM allocation to OS.
